Notice of the opening of "Shina ", an art gallery filled with Japan's beauty in Ginza

March 5, 2020

20200305_1.jpg

Takihyo Co., Ltd. (Head Office: Nishi-ku, Nagoya, President and Representative Director/Corporate Executive Officer: Kazuo Taki) will open "Shina", an art gallery filled with Japan's beauty on March 19, 2020 in Ginza. Original creations incorporating ancient Japanese patterns, from Japanese traditional crafts to modern pop art and subculture, all carefully selected items to be displayed and sold.

The 1st floor is a peaceful and relaxing space featuring traditional Japanese crafts.
With subculture as its theme, the 2nd floor is a futuristic space where original creations fused with Japanese crafts can be enjoyed.
This is an art gallery full of the past, present and future of Japanese craftsmanship.
